public void StatusPatientDocumentIssue_curStat1() { using (TestMqServiceClient mq = new TestMqServiceClient()) { //Задаём статус направления "Зарегистрировано в РЕГИЗ.УО" Referral referral = (new SetData()).MinRegister(); Credentials cr = new Credentials { Organization = idLpu, Token = guid }; var result = mq.Register(cr, referral); //Задаём статус "Выдано пациенту" referral = (new SetData()).SetStatus_PatientDocumentIssue(result.IdMq); var res2 = mq.UpdateFromSourcedMo(cr, referral); if (res2.MqReferralStatus.Code != "3") { Global.errors1.Add("Неверный статус:" + res2.MqReferralStatus.Code + ""); } } if (Global.errors == "") { Assert.Pass(); } else { Assert.Fail(Global.errors); } }
public void StatusAgreedInTargedMO() { using (TestMqServiceClient mq = new TestMqServiceClient()) { //Задаём статус направления "Зарегистрировано в РЕГИЗ.УО" Referral referral = (new SetData()).MinRegister(); Credentials cr = new Credentials { Organization = idLpu, Token = guid }; var result = mq.Register(cr, referral); //Задаём статус "Выдано пациенту" referral = (new SetData()).SetStatus_PatientDocumentIssue(result.IdMq); var res2 = mq.UpdateFromSourcedMo(cr, referral); //Задаём статус "Признано обоснованным в целевой МО" referral = (new SetData()).SetStatus_AgreedInTargedMO(result.IdMq); var res3 = mq.UpdateFromTargetMo(cr, referral); if (res3.MqReferralStatus.Code != "4") Global.errors1.Add("Неверный статус:" + res3.MqReferralStatus.Code + ""); } if (Global.errors == "") Assert.Pass(); else Assert.Fail(Global.errors); }
public void StatusCancellation_CurStat2() { using (TestMqServiceClient mq = new TestMqServiceClient()) { //Задаём статус направления "Зарегистрировано в РЕГИЗ.УО" Referral referral = (new SetData()).MinRegister(); Credentials cr = new Credentials { Organization = idLpu, Token = guid }; var result = mq.Register(cr, referral); //Задаём статус "Согласовано в направляющей МО" referral = (new SetData()).SetStatus_AgreedInSourcedMO(result.IdMq); var res2 = mq.UpdateFromSourcedMo(cr, referral); //Задаём статус "Аннулировано" referral = (new SetData()).MinCancellation(result.IdMq); var res3 = mq.Cancellation(cr, referral); if (res3.MqReferralStatus.Code != "0") { Global.errors1.Add("Неверный статус:" + res3.MqReferralStatus.Code + ""); } } if (Global.errors == "") { Assert.Pass(); } else { Assert.Fail(Global.errors); } }
public void StatusRegister() { using (TestMqServiceClient mq = new TestMqServiceClient()) { Referral referral = (new SetData()).MinRegister(); Credentials cr = new Credentials { Organization = idLpu, Token = guid }; var result = mq.Register(cr, referral); if (result.MqReferralStatus.Code != "1") { Global.errors1.Add("Неверный статус:" + result.MqReferralStatus.Code + ""); } } if (Global.errors == "") { Assert.Pass(); } else { Assert.Fail(Global.errors); } }
//Задаём статус "Согласовано в направляющей МО" public void StatusAgreedInSourcedMO() { using (TestMqServiceClient mq = new TestMqServiceClient()) { //Задаём статус "Зарегистрировано в РЕГИЗ.УО" Referral referral = (new SetData()).SetStatusRegisterMin(); Credentials cr = new Credentials { Organization = idLpu, Token = guid }; var result = mq.Register(cr, referral); //Задаём статус "Согласовано в направляющей МО" // с помощью метода UpdateFromSourcedMo() referral = (new SetData()).SetStatusAgreedInSourcedMO_UpdateFromSourcedMo(result.IdMq); var res2 = mq.UpdateFromSourcedMo(cr, referral); if (res2.MqReferralStatus.Code != "Согласовано в направляющей МО") { Global.errors1.Add("Неверный статус:" + result.MqReferralStatus.Code + ""); } } if (Global.errors == "") { Assert.Pass(); } else { Assert.Fail(Global.errors); } }
public void MinRegister() { using (TestMqServiceClient mq = new TestMqServiceClient()) { Referral referral = (new SetData()).MinRegister(); Credentials cr = new Credentials { Organization = idLpu, Token = guid }; var result = mq.Register(cr, referral); if (Global.errors == "") Assert.Pass(); else Assert.Fail(Global.errors); } }
public void TestMethod1() { using (TestMqServiceClient client = new TestMqServiceClient()) { Credentials cr = new Credentials { Organization = "1.2.643.5.1.13.3.25.78.6", Token = "dda0e909-93cd-4549-b7ff-d1caaa1f0bc2" }; Referral[] r = client.SearchMany(cr, new WebReference.Options { IdMq = "78154000000101", Source = new WebReference.ReferralSource { Lpu = new WebReference.Coding { Code = "1.2.643.5.1.13.3.25.78.125", System = "urn:oid:1.2.643.2.69.1.1.1.64" } }, ReferralInfo = new ReferralInfo { MqReferralStatus = new Coding { Code = "1", System = "urn:oid:1.2.643.2.69.1.1.1.50" } } }).Referrals; //List<string> a = TestOptions.GetReferralId(new WebReference.Options //{ // IdMq = "78154000000101", // Source = new WebReference.ReferralSource // { // Lpu = new WebReference.Coding // { // Code = "1.2.643.5.1.13.3.25.78.125", // System = "urn:oid:1.2.643.2.69.1.1.1.64" // } // } //}); } if (Global.errors != "") { Assert.Fail(Global.errors); } }
public void StatusRegister() { using (TestMqServiceClient mq = new TestMqServiceClient()) { Referral referral = (new SetData()).SetStatusRegisterMin(); Credentials cr = new Credentials { Organization = idLpu, Token = guid }; var result = mq.Register(cr, referral); if (result.MqReferralStatus.Code != "Зарегистрировано в РЕГИЗ.УО") Global.errors1.Add("Неверный статус:" + result.MqReferralStatus.Code + ""); } if (Global.errors == "") Assert.Pass(); else Assert.Fail(Global.errors); }
public void TestMethod1() { using (TestMqServiceClient client = new TestMqServiceClient()) { Credentials cr = new Credentials { Organization = "1.2.643.5.1.13.3.25.78.6", Token = "dda0e909-93cd-4549-b7ff-d1caaa1f0bc2" }; Referral[] r = client.SearchMany(cr, new WebReference.Options { IdMq = "78154000000101", Source = new WebReference.ReferralSource { Lpu = new WebReference.Coding { Code = "1.2.643.5.1.13.3.25.78.125", System = "urn:oid:1.2.643.2.69.1.1.1.64" } }, ReferralInfo = new ReferralInfo { MqReferralStatus = new Coding { Code = "1", System = "urn:oid:1.2.643.2.69.1.1.1.50" } } }).Referrals; //List<string> a = TestOptions.GetReferralId(new WebReference.Options //{ // IdMq = "78154000000101", // Source = new WebReference.ReferralSource // { // Lpu = new WebReference.Coding // { // Code = "1.2.643.5.1.13.3.25.78.125", // System = "urn:oid:1.2.643.2.69.1.1.1.64" // } // } //}); } if (Global.errors != "") Assert.Fail(Global.errors); }
public void MinRegister() { using (TestMqServiceClient mq = new TestMqServiceClient()) { Referral referral = (new SetData()).MinRegister(); Credentials cr = new Credentials { Organization = idLpu, Token = guid }; var result = mq.Register(cr, referral); } if (Global.errors == "") { Assert.Pass(); } else { Assert.Fail(Global.errors); } }
public void StatusAgreedInSourcedMO_CurStat1() { using (TestMqServiceClient mq = new TestMqServiceClient()) { //Задаём статус "Зарегистрировано в РЕГИЗ.УО" Referral referral = (new SetData()).MinRegister(); Credentials cr = new Credentials { Organization = idLpu, Token = guid }; var result = mq.Register(cr, referral); //Задаём статус "Согласовано в направляющей МО" referral = (new SetData()).SetStatus_AgreedInSourcedMO(result.IdMq); var res2 = mq.UpdateFromSourcedMo(cr, referral); if (res2.MqReferralStatus.Code != "2") Global.errors1.Add("Неверный статус:" + res2.MqReferralStatus.Code + ""); } if (Global.errors == "") Assert.Pass(); else Assert.Fail(Global.errors); }
public void FullRegister() { using (TestMqServiceClient mq = new TestMqServiceClient()) { Referral referral = (new SetData()).FullRegister(); Credentials cr = new Credentials { Organization = idLpu, Token = guid }; try { var result = mq.Register(cr, referral); } catch (FaultException<MqTests.WebReference.MqFault> e) { string s = e.Detail.MqFaults[0].Message; } //if (Global.errors == "") // Assert.Pass(); //else // Assert.Fail(Global.errors); } }
public void StatusCancellation_CurStat1() { using (TestMqServiceClient mq = new TestMqServiceClient()) { //Задаём статус направления "Зарегистрировано в РЕГИЗ.УО" Referral referral = (new SetData()).MinRegister(); Credentials cr = new Credentials { Organization = idLpu, Token = guid }; var result = mq.Register(cr, referral); //Задаём статус "Аннулировано" referral = (new SetData()).MinCancellation(result.IdMq); var res2 = mq.Cancellation(cr, referral); if (res2.MqReferralStatus.Code != "0") Global.errors1.Add("Неверный статус:" + res2.MqReferralStatus.Code + ""); } if (Global.errors == "") Assert.Pass(); else Assert.Fail(Global.errors); }
public void FullRegister() { using (TestMqServiceClient mq = new TestMqServiceClient()) { Referral referral = (new SetData()).FullRegister(); Credentials cr = new Credentials { Organization = idLpu, Token = guid }; try { var result = mq.Register(cr, referral); } catch (FaultException <MqTests.WebReference.MqFault> e) { string s = e.Detail.MqFaults[0].Message; } //if (Global.errors == "") // Assert.Pass(); //else // Assert.Fail(Global.errors); } }